-/*
- The purpose of this file is to make it easy to write modules
- that will compile correctly for multiple kernel versions.
- This file can only provide backward compatibility, i.e.,
- write your driver for 2.3.x, include this header file, and
- theoretically, it will compile and run on 2.0.37. However,
- some interface changes require superset definitions to
- allow compilation for all supported kernel versions, so
- you have to use the interface provided in this file to
- compile for all kernels.
-
- If your driver is written for the 2.2.x interface, define
- COMPAT_V22 before including this file.
-*/
